I love trans bodies.  I have one myself.  So does my primary partner.  Trans love, queer love, special sex.

I understand the special complications that being trans brings into intimacy and relationships.  There is all of the internal stuff: 
  • If I pass, when do I disclose?  
  • How do I tell my partner/s what I want, when I'm still figuring out how my body works?  
  • How can I learn "sexy" in this changed/changing body?  
  • What do I even like anymore? 

And when you add to the mix other marginalized identities like kinky, queer, and others,  confusion can really prevail. Plus, there is dealing with all of other people's stuff: tokenization, fetishization, overt curiosity about our sex, our bits, our bodies. Super hard to navigate!

I'm a big believer that we ALL get sexy.

We all get to express our erotic nature, and it doesn't have to make sense to anyone except for us.  I work with a lot of trans spectrum clients.  Sometimes our work is hands-on Sexological Bodywork, and sometimes its more traditonal talk sex therapy.  Being able to meet you wherever you are in relation to your body, your gender identity and your relationships is my super power.  I will support you while we sort through it together.  I will be there as you craft the erotic life you truly want for yourself.  And I do it with utmost compassion, understanding and love.

Trans Women (MTF)

I really love helping trans women come home to their bodies and their pleasure.  I work with all women. I understand there are many different expressions of trans; pre-op, post-op, no-op, hormones, no-ho, etc. I deeply honor the journey you are on, and look forward to helping you feel really, really good.  

Things that Sexological Bodywork can help with include relearning pleasure in a changed/changing body, redefining sensation and retraining nerves, scar tissue remediation after surgery, pleasure mapping.  The sex therapy part of our work can help sort out the erotic self, any relationship issues, and work with pleasure, desire, boundaries and energy.
